Hy neox
The problem is on the new calendarview. To deactivate the calendarview please open the file C:ProgramsMyPhoneExplorergeneral.ini , goto Section [Main] and make this entry:
[Main]
CalendarView=0
It could be that it works then. Please write me also a short mail, so i can reach you. I would be very thankful if you could help me to find the bug. My mailaddy: fj.wechselberger<at>gmx.at
